How to cut clips in imovie on iphone

As many you asked, how do I cut out parts of a video on iMovie on iPhone?

  1. Tap a clip in the timeline to reveal the inspector at the bottom of the screen, tap the Actions button , then tap Split.
  2. Tap the clip (it becomes outlined in yellow), then swipe down over the playhead to split the clip, as if you were using your finger to slice through it.

Furthermore, how do you cut clips on iPhone?

  1. Open the Photos app and tap the video that you want to edit.
  2. Tap Edit.
  3. Move the sliders on both sides of the video timeline to change the start and stop times. To preview your trimmed video, tap the play button .
  4. Tap Done, then tap Save Video or Save Video as New Clip.

Amazingly, how do you cut and edit in iMovie on iPhone?

  1. With your project open, tap the video clip or photo in the timeline. A yellow highlight appears around the selected clip.
  2. To zoom in on the clip, pinch open in the centre of the timeline.
  3. Drag the beginning or end of the clip to make the clip shorter or longer:

Why can’t I split clip in iMovie?

You can’t split a clip in the Event browser. To split a video clip into two parts: Open a project so that it’s showing in the Project browser, and then do one of the following: Rest the playhead (the red vertical line) at the point where you want to split the clip, and then press Command-Shift-S.

How do I use iMovie on my iPhone?

  1. In the Projects browser, tap the plus button .
  2. Tap Movie.
  3. Touch and hold image thumbnails to preview photos at a larger size or to preview video clips.
  4. Tap an individual video clip or a photo that you want to include in your movie, or tap Select to choose an entire moment.
